The Management School hosted an event on Wednesday 10th October to welcome its MBA and master’s scholarship holders. 

The event was held at the Liverpool Everyman theatre and gave students the opportunity to network with other scholarship holders and meet academics from across the programmes. 

Attendees heard from Julia Balogun, Dean of the Management School, Lisa Anderson, Associate Dean Postgraduate, and Elizabeth Maitland, Associate Dean MBA about the many opportunities available to them as postgraduate students at the School.  These opportunities include a wide range of guest speakers, masterclasses, careers support, the ExECS award and the master’s consultancy challenge which was launched last year. 

Scholarships are awarded to students with a strong academic background to help cover the cost of tuition.   The Management School prides itself on its diversity and this year has scholarship holders from 23 different nationalities, reflecting its mission “to be a globally connected Management School, whose transformative research and teaching places us at the forefront of influential knowledge leadership”. 

Lisa Anderson, Associate Dean Postgraduate, said “It was great to meet the scholarship holders and to hear about their experiences in Liverpool so far. I was very impressed by their enthusiasm and their commitment to set and achieve challenging goals. I am sure they will bring a great deal to the ULMS Masters community.”
